After "INIT" on the display disappears, turn the unit off and on again. ≥No Changing the delay time (Speaker Setting) (Effective when playing multi-channel audio) (Center and surround speakers only) For optimum listening with 5.1-channel sound, all the speakers, except for the subwoofer, should be the same distance from the seating position. If you have to place the center or surround speakers closer to the seating position, adjust the delay time to make up for the difference. If either distance a or b is less than c, find the difference in the relevant table and change to the recommended setting. : Recommended placement L C R ac SW b LS RS a Center speaker Difference Approx. 34 cm (11/10 feet) Approx. 68 cm (21/5 feet) Approx. 102 cm (33/10 feet) Approx. 136 cm (42/5 feet) Approx. 170 cm (51/2 feet) Setting 1.0 ms 2.0 ms 3.0 ms 4.0 ms 5.0 ms b Surround speaker Difference Approx. 170 cm (51/2 feet) Approx. 340 cm (11 feet) Approx. 510 cm (161/2 feet) Setting 5.0 ms 10.0 ms 15.0 ms To finish the speaker setting Press [2] to select "Exit" and press [ENTER]. When you change the surround speaker setting for Dolby Digital, the setting also changes for Dolby Pro Logic II. e.g., the settings for MUSIC and PANORAMA are the same as those for Dolby Digital.
